Frequently Asked Questions Regarding Carbonite Phone Number Support

This section addresses common inquiries concerning access to and utilization of Carbonite’s telephone-based support services.

Question 1: How does one locate the correct telephone number for Carbonite technical assistance?

The designated telephone number for Carbonite technical assistance is typically available on the official Carbonite website, within the user’s account portal, or in the product documentation. Contacting the appropriate number ensures access to qualified support personnel.

Question 2: What are the standard operating hours for Carbonite’s telephone support?

Carbonite’s telephone support availability varies. Prospective users should consult the official Carbonite website or contact pre-sales support to ascertain the specific hours of operation to ensure support is available during necessary times.

Question 3: Is there a charge associated with contacting Carbonite technical assistance by telephone?

The availability of toll-free access depends on the user’s subscription level and geographic location. Investigating available options before contacting support is prudent to avoid unexpected charges.

Question 4: What information should be prepared prior to contacting Carbonite’s telephone support?

Before initiating contact with Carbonites telephone support, have the Carbonite account number, product license key, a detailed description of the issue, and any relevant error messages readily available. Supplying this information will expedite the troubleshooting process.

Question 5: What escalation procedures are in place should the initial telephone support contact prove insufficient?

Carbonite maintains internal escalation procedures for cases requiring advanced technical expertise. If the initial support representative cannot resolve the issue, the case should be elevated to a higher-tier support team or specialized engineer for further investigation.

Question 6: Are language options available when contacting Carbonite’s telephone support?

The availability of multilingual telephone support depends on the user’s geographic location and the specific support resources available. Confirming the availability of support in a preferred language prior to initiating the call is recommended.

Tips for Efficient Carbonite Phone Number Support

The following guidelines aim to facilitate efficient resolution of technical issues through Carbonite’s telephone support channel.

Tip 1: Prioritize Online Resources: Before initiating phone contact, exhaust available online resources such as the knowledge base, FAQs, and video tutorials. Many common issues have readily available solutions, potentially negating the need for phone assistance.

Tip 2: Document Error Messages: Accurately record any error messages encountered. Providing support personnel with precise error codes and descriptions significantly accelerates the diagnostic process.

Tip 3: Gather Account Information: Ensure that the Carbonite account number, product license key, and relevant subscription details are readily accessible. This information is required for account verification and streamlines the support process.

Tip 4: Clearly Articulate the Problem: Concisely describe the issue experienced, including the steps taken to reproduce the problem and the desired outcome. Precise communication enhances the support representative’s understanding of the situation.

Tip 5: Manage Expectations Regarding Wait Times: Be aware that wait times for phone support may vary depending on call volume and support tier. Exercise patience and anticipate a potential delay before connecting with a representative.

Tip 6: Maintain a Record of Communication: Note the date, time, and name of the support representative with whom the interaction occurs. This record facilitates follow-up communication and ensures accountability.

Tip 7: Escalate if Necessary: If the initial support interaction does not yield a satisfactory resolution, do not hesitate to request escalation to a senior technician or specialized support team. Clearly articulate the reasons for the escalation request.

Adhering to these tips promotes effective communication, facilitates accurate diagnostics, and accelerates problem resolution during telephone interactions with Carbonite support.
